Cloudian HyperIQ: Enhanced Security

Summary

Cloudian has updated its HyperIQ platform with new security and management features. These enhancements include improved replication monitoring, federated management for multiple clusters, enhanced ransomware protection, and single sign-on capabilities. These updates simplify management and bolster security for geographically dispersed HyperStore object storage environments.

Security Boosts

So, what’s new in the security department? Well, here are some highlights:

  • Ransomware Protection: This is a big one. They’ve beefed up protection against ransomware, giving you detailed info on storage objects that are locked down for protection.   • Single Sign-On (SSO): HyperIQ now supports SSO. It’s a simple thing, but it can make your life easier. Streamlines user management and boosts security. It means only authorized people can get into the sensitive stuff. It’s a no-brainer.

Easier Management

Managing storage shouldn’t feel like herding cats. Here’s how HyperIQ is trying to make it easier:

  • Federated Management: Think about this: You can now manage multiple storage clusters from a single HyperIQ instance. All within one virtual machine. It’s like having a unified command center. This consolidated view simplifies things, cuts down on admin work, and makes everything run smoother. It’s what you want, isn’t it?
  • Cross-Region Replication Monitoring: If your data is spread across different locations, keeping an eye on replication is crucial. HyperIQ now includes cross-region replication monitoring. Giving you a full view of what’s happening, including network traffic and performance between those HyperStore clusters. You can spot potential problems before they cause headaches.

More Than Just New Features

It’s worth noting that HyperIQ already had a pretty solid set of features before these updates. Some of them, like:

  • Intelligent Monitoring: Real-time dashboards provide complete visibility into the storage infrastructure.
  • Customizable Dashboards: Users can create custom dashboards tailored to their specific needs, providing a personalized view of the most critical metrics.
  • Predictive Maintenance: Proactive alerts help predict hardware failures and assess maintenance needs. Minimizing downtime and ensuring optimal system performance.
  • User Behavior Analytics: Monitor user activity to identify usage patterns, ensure data security, and enforce compliance policies.

  1. The enhanced ransomware protection, particularly the visibility into locked storage objects, is a valuable addition. How does HyperIQ integrate with existing security information and event management (SIEM) systems to provide a more holistic security posture?

    • Great question! The integration with SIEM systems is key for that holistic view. HyperIQ leverages standard protocols like syslog and REST APIs to feed security event data into your existing SIEM, enriching those platforms with object storage-specific insights. This allows for correlation with other security events and a faster incident response.
